Dharmendra Pradhan Resigns Amid Nationwide Protests; Activists Call It Democratic Victory

Analysed 25 Jul 2026·13 sources analysed·New Delhi, India·Politics
Dharmendra Pradhan Resigns Amid Nationwide Protests; Activists Call It Democratic VictoryPreviousNext

Union Education Minister Dharmendra Pradhan resigned following weeks of nationwide protests led by the Cockroach Janata Party (CJP) and supported by students and citizens, including activist Sonam Wangchuk. Wangchuk hailed the resignation as a "victory of democracy," crediting peaceful, sustained public pressure and Gen Z's role. He called for moving beyond accountability toward broader reforms. Opposition leaders also praised the outcome as a democratic success, while Pradhan cited protecting students' future and national unity in his resignation.
